Optimizing Injection Molding Machine Settings

To reduce energy consumption, we start with machine parameters. Operators can try to adjust the injection speed, pressure and temperature to the lowest sufficient value – for example. The holding pressure is usually set to 50%-80% of the injection pressure. When adjusting, you have to take your time, change only one parameter at a time. And watch the product status while adjusting. So as to ensure complete mold filling without flashing and avoid excessive power consumption.

By the way, the mold temperature should also be kept in mind. According to the surface quality and cooling time of the product, flexibly adjust to find a balance point that makes the cooling speed reasonable and ensures the appearance quality. Speed ​​control is recommended to be operated in stages: low-speed filling at the beginning to prevent spray marks, and high-speed filling in the later stage to reduce weld marks.

The most important thing is to accurately grasp the molding cycle time. For example, the metering stroke should be slightly shorter than the theoretical value, the cooling time should be appropriately extended, and the total injection time should be slightly shortened. Take a notebook to write down the parameter changes and product effects every time you make adjustments. So that you can have a reference when you encounter similar situations next time.

Energy-efficient components of reduce power consumption of machine

We have found that using energy-saving components can effectively reduce the overall power consumption of the equipment. For example, in actual production, replacing traditional hydraulic systems with servo motors can significantly reduce energy consumption by 50% -70% – a surprising figure! Servo motors not only save electricity, but also provide more precise control over the operational details of the injection molding process.

In addition, the lighting of the device control panel is also worth paying attention to: LED lights save more than 80% of electricity compared to old-fashioned incandescent lamps. And long-term use can significantly reduce electricity costs.

Regular maintenance of reduce power consumption of machine

Regular maintenance of equipment can indeed help you save on electricity bills. The specific operations include: timely cleaning of heating components, careful inspection for leakage, and adding lubricating oil to moving parts. Persist in doing these maintenance tasks, and the equipment will operate more stably. Not only can it last longer, but it can also significantly reduce electricity consumption – in the long run, this electricity bill can be saved a lot.

Educate and Train Staff

When operators see firsthand how their actions affect energy consumption data, they will be more proactive in taking energy-saving measures. For example, the production supervisor can guide the team to shut down equipment in a timely manner when it is idle, regularly check the energy consumption readings on the dashboard. And these small actions can significantly reduce the factory’s electricity consumption when accumulated
